Design and Aesthetics
Raised panel garage doors feature a series of rectangular panels that protrude slightly from the surface of the door, creating a textured and dimensional look. This design is traditional and timeless, often associated with a classic architectural style. The raised panels can be small or large, depending on the specific design, and can be arranged in various configurations to complement the home’s exterior.
In contrast, other styles such as flat panel, carriage house, and contemporary garage doors offer different aesthetic appeals. Flat panel doors have a sleek, smooth surface without any protruding elements, providing a more modern and minimalistic look. Carriage house doors mimic the appearance of old carriage house doors, with decorative hardware and a rustic charm that suits traditional and country-style homes. Contemporary doors, on the other hand, often feature clean lines, large glass panels, and modern materials, catering to modern and avant-garde architectural designs.

Materials and Durability
Raised panel garage doors are available in various materials, including steel, wood, aluminum, and composite materials. Steel is a popular choice due to its durability, low maintenance, and resistance to weather elements. Wood offers a warm, natural look but requires regular maintenance to protect it from moisture and pests. Aluminum is lightweight and resistant to rust, making it suitable for coastal areas, but it can dent easily. Composite materials combine the best properties of wood and steel, providing the look of wood with the durability of steel.
Other styles of garage doors also use these materials, but the choice of material can significantly impact the durability and maintenance requirements. For example, contemporary garage doors often incorporate glass and aluminum, which are stylish but may require more frequent cleaning and maintenance. Carriage house doors, typically made of wood or composite materials, need more upkeep to maintain their rustic appeal.

Functionality and Insulation
Functionality is a crucial aspect when choosing a garage door. Raised panel doors are generally available in both insulated and non-insulated versions. Insulated doors provide better thermal efficiency, helping to maintain the temperature inside the garage and reducing energy costs. They are especially beneficial in regions with extreme temperatures.
Flat panel doors can also be insulated or non-insulated, with similar benefits. Carriage house doors, depending on the material, may offer varying levels of insulation. Contemporary doors, with their large glass panels, might not provide the same level of insulation as solid doors, but modern glass options can offer improved thermal performance.

Cost and Value
The cost of raised panel garage doors varies based on the material, size, and level of customization. Generally, steel raised panel doors are more affordable, while wood and composite options are more expensive due to their material costs and maintenance requirements. Custom designs and finishes can also increase the price.
Comparatively, flat panel doors are often less expensive due to their simple design. Carriage house doors, with their intricate details and often custom-built nature, tend to be on the higher end of the cost spectrum. Contemporary doors, especially those with large glass panels and modern materials, can also be quite costly.
When it comes to adding value to a home, all garage door styles can enhance curb appeal and potentially increase resale value. However, the choice should align with the home’s architectural style and the homeowner’s personal preferences. A well-chosen garage door can make a significant difference in the overall impression of the property.
Maintenance and Longevity
Maintenance requirements and the longevity of garage doors depend largely on the material and design. Raised panel doors made of steel are relatively low-maintenance, needing occasional cleaning and periodic inspections to ensure the hardware and springs are in good condition. Wood raised panel doors require regular painting or staining to protect them from moisture and UV damage.
Flat panel doors, especially those made of steel or aluminum, are also low-maintenance. Carriage house doors, often crafted from wood, demand more attention to preserve their appearance and functionality. Contemporary doors with large glass panels require regular cleaning to maintain their aesthetic appeal and ensure the glass remains in good condition.

In terms of longevity, steel and composite doors generally last longer due to their resistance to environmental factors. Wood doors, while beautiful, have a shorter lifespan unless meticulously maintained. Aluminum doors can last long but are prone to dents and scratches.
Customization Options
Raised panel garage doors offer a range of customization options. Homeowners can choose from different panel configurations, materials, colors, and finishes to match their home’s exterior. Decorative hardware, windows, and insulation levels can also be customized to enhance both the appearance and functionality of the door.
Other garage door styles also offer customization possibilities. Flat panel doors can be painted in various colors and finishes, while carriage house doors can be adorned with decorative hardware and window inserts to enhance their rustic look. Contemporary doors can be customized with different types of glass, frame colors, and finishes to achieve a sleek, modern appearance.

Energy Efficiency
Energy efficiency is an important consideration for many homeowners, especially those living in areas with extreme weather conditions. Raised panel garage doors with insulation can significantly improve the thermal efficiency of the garage, keeping it cooler in summer and warmer in winter. This can reduce energy consumption and lower utility bills.
Flat panel doors with insulation offer similar benefits, while carriage house doors, depending on the material and insulation level, can also provide good thermal performance. Contemporary doors with large glass panels may have lower energy efficiency, but modern insulated glass options can help mitigate this issue.
Security Features
Security is a top priority for homeowners, and garage doors play a vital role in protecting the home. Raised panel garage doors, like other styles, can be equipped with various security features such as robust locking mechanisms, reinforced panels, and smart openers with rolling code technology to prevent unauthorized access.
Flat panel and contemporary doors also offer similar security features, ensuring the safety of the home. Carriage house doors, while aesthetically appealing, should also be equipped with strong locks and security systems to provide adequate protection.

What is a raised panel garage door?
A raised panel is generally a thicker panel with a beveled edge or other detail cut into the perimeter, also surrounded by a framework. This appearance may be stamped into the face of a steel product.
